Deleting file works but adding a file doesn't

I have been using serviio on a mac with several folders shared with some samsung TVs that play a slideshow and it all works fine.
HOWEVER serviio does NOT appear to detect that I have added a photo to the directory despite the fact that I have told serviio to scan the directory for updates every minute.
The weird thing is that if I delete a file from the directory, the TV that is playing the slideshow performs as expected & the file is no longer displayed.
But if I add a new photo to that directory... it never shows up on the TV unless I force a refresh on the serviio console.
Any ideas?
